# Ansible Role: Munin
[![Build Status](https://travis-ci.org/geerlingguy/ansible-role-munin.svg?branch=master)](https://travis-ci.org/geerlingguy/ansible-role-munin)
Installs munin, a monitoring system, on RedHat/CentOS or Debian/Ubuntu Linux servers.
## Requirements
If you are running a RedHat-based distribution, you need to install the EPEL repository, which can be simply installed via the `geerlingguy.repo-epel` role.
If you would like to view munin's graphs and output via HTTP, you will need an HTTP server like Apache or Nginx running.
## Role Variables
Available variables are listed below, along with default values (see `vars/main.yml`):
munin_dbdir: /var/lib/munin
munin_htmldir: /var/www/html/munin
munin_logdir: /var/log/munin
munin_rundir: /var/run/munin
munin_includedir: /etc/munin/conf.d
Some default locations for Munin-generated files, configurations, logs, etc.
munin_html_strategy: cron
munin_max_processes: 12
See the official Munin documentation for [munin.conf](http://munin.readthedocs.org/en/latest/reference/munin.conf.html) for more information on these and other optional directives.
munin_admin_user: munin
munin_admin_password: munin
These values will be used to generate a user via htpasswd under which the munin pages will be password protected with basic HTTP authentication.
munin_hosts:
- {
name: "localhost",
address: "127.0.0.1",
extra: ["use_node_name yes"]
}
A listing of hosts to which munin will connect and monitor. Each item in the list will be added to your munin configuration like the following (assuming you're using the above example):
[localhost]
address: 127.0.0.1
use_node_name yes
See documentation for [Munin Node Definitions](http://munin.readthedocs.org/en/latest/reference/munin.conf.html#node-definitions) for more details as to what values to use here.
You can enable mail alerts by adding :
munin_alerts:
- {
name: "John Doe",
email: "johndoe@example.com",
subject: "Munin-notification for ${var:group} :: ${var:host}",
level: "warning critical"
}

## Example Playbook
- hosts: servers
roles:
- { role: geerlingguy.munin }
